Roux-en-Y gastric bypass (RYGB) is a widely performed bariatric surgery designed to help individuals with morbid obesity achieve significant weight loss and improve obesity-related health conditions. This surgical procedure involves creating a small pouch at the top of the stomach using surgical staples, which limits the amount of food the patient can consume at one time. The new pouch is then connected directly to the small intestine, bypassing a portion of the stomach and the first part of the intestine, known as the duodenum. This rerouting not only restricts food intake but also alters the digestive process, leading to reduced calorie absorption. Patients often experience dramatic weight loss due in part to the early feeling of fullness after eating only a small amount of food, as well as hormonal changes that affect appetite and metabolism. The indication for Roux-en-Y gastric bypass primarily revolves around severe obesity, often defined as a body mass index (BMI) greater than 40 or a BMI over 35 with obesity-related health issues such as type 2 diabetes, hypertension, sleep apnea, or joint problems. The underlying cause of obesity can range from genetic predispositions, an imbalance in calorie intake versus calorie expenditure, hormonal influences, environmental factors, and psychological components that instigate compulsive eating behaviors. The surgery aims to provide a tool for sustainable weight loss, enabling patients to make meaningful lifestyle changes. Research supports that RYGB can lead to improvements in metabolic syndrome, often resulting in remission of type 2 diabetes and reductions in cardiovascular risk factors. However, RYGB is not a quick fix; it necessitates a lifelong commitment to dietary modifications, regular physical activity, and routine medical follow-up to monitor nutritional deficiencies and overall health. Potential risks associated with this surgery include surgical complications like infections, blood clots, gastrointestinal leaks, and nutritional deficits due to altered digestion and absorption. Patients may need to take vitamin and mineral supplements for life, particularly for vitamins B12, D, and iron, to prevent deficiencies. Following the procedure, individuals typically adapt to a new eating pattern, beginning with liquids and gradually transitioning to solid foods, often under the guidance of a healthcare team, including nutritionists and counselors. This multidisciplinary approach is crucial in ensuring the long-term success of the surgery, as effective psychological support helps tackle behavioral and emotional eating issues. In summary, the Roux-en-Y gastric bypass is a powerful surgical intervention for individuals struggling with severe obesity and related health problems, offering a pathway to improved health and quality of life when combined with ongoing lifestyle changes and medical support. Ensuring that candidates fully understand the commitment involved, both before and after surgery, can help set realistic expectations and foster a successful weight loss journey.
